Output 128908385ddce69e9d0c82063eb02676013964dfaea212067b819b96909f3a66:4

value
343524
script pubkey
OP_0 OP_PUSHBYTES_20 6b1f66c9cc20561563300d7454cf19106c7e43a8
address
bc1qdv0kdjwvyptp2cesp469fncezpk8usaggx2nvu
transaction
128908385ddce69e9d0c82063eb02676013964dfaea212067b819b96909f3a66
spent
true